站长工具亚洲高清,个人网站建设研究意义,ssp媒体服怎样做网站,班级设计网站建设关于ES#xff1a;ElasticSearch是一个事实分布式搜索和分析引擎#xff0c;使用其可以以前所未有的速度处理大数据#xff0c;他用于全文搜索、结构化搜索、分析以及将这三者混合使用。维基百科使用ElasticSearch提供全文搜索并高亮关键字#xff0c;以及输入实时搜索(sea…关于ESElasticSearch是一个事实分布式搜索和分析引擎使用其可以以前所未有的速度处理大数据他用于全文搜索、结构化搜索、分析以及将这三者混合使用。维基百科使用ElasticSearch提供全文搜索并高亮关键字以及输入实时搜索(searchasyoutype)等搜索纠错(didyoumean)等搜索建议功能。ElasticSearch是一个基于Apache Lucene(TM)的开源搜索引擎。无论在开源还是在专有领域Lucene可以被认为是迄今最先进、性能最好的、功能最全的搜索引擎库。
关于Solrsolr是Apache下的一个顶级开源项目采用java开发它是基于Lucene的全文搜索服务器。solr提供了比Lucene更为丰富的查询语言同时实现了可配置、可扩展、并对索引、搜索性能进行了优化。solr可以独立运行运行在Jetty、Tomcat等这些Servlet容器中solr索引是实现方法很简单用post方法向solr服务器发送一个描述Field及其内容的xml文档solr根据xml文档添加、删除、更新索引。
二者之间对比
相同点
都是基于Lucene都是对Lucene的封装
不同点 使用 Solr安装略微复杂一些es基本的开箱急用非常简单 接口 Solr类似webservice的接口es是基于restful风格的访问接口 分布式储存 solrCloud solr4.x才支持 es是为分布式而生的 支持的格式 solr支持更多的格式数据比如Json、xml、CSVes仅支持json文件格式 近实时搜索的角度 Solr查询快但更新索引时慢(即插入删除慢)用于电商等查询多的应用ES建立索引快(即查询慢) 即实时性查询快用于facebook新浪等搜索。solr是传统的搜索应用的有力的解决方案但是 ElasticSearch更适合用于新兴的实时搜索应用
百度指数Baidu Index是以百度海量网民行为数据为基础的数据分析平台是当前互联网乃至整个数据时代最重要的统计分析平台之一自发布之日便成为众多企业营销决策的重要依据。
百度指数是以百度海量网民行为数据为基础的数据分享平台。在这里你可以研究关键词搜索趋势、洞察网民需求变化、监测媒体舆情趋势、定位数字消费者特征还可以从行业的角度分析市场特点。